I am trying to install the sqlite3-ruby gem on my Mac, which is running an M1 Pro chip.
The installation fails with the following output:

I installed sqlite3 via Homebrew, with the following output:
sqlite: stable 3.37.2 (bottled) [keg-only]
Command-line interface for SQLite
https://sqlite.org/index.html
/opt/homebrew/Cellar/sqlite/3.37.2 (11 files, 4.3MB)
Poured from bottle on 2022-02-15 at 13:01:01
From: https://github.com/Homebrew/homebrew-core/blob/HEAD/Formula/sqlite.rb
License: blessing
==> Dependencies
Required: readline ✔
==> Caveats
sqlite is keg-only, which means it was not symlinked into /opt/homebrew,
because macOS already provides this software and installing another version in
parallel can cause all kinds of trouble.
If you need to have sqlite first in your PATH, run:
echo 'export PATH="/opt/homebrew/opt/sqlite/bin:$PATH"' >> ~/.zshrc
For compilers to find sqlite you may need to set:
export LDFLAGS="-L/opt/homebrew/opt/sqlite/lib"
export CPPFLAGS="-I/opt/homebrew/opt/sqlite/include"
For pkg-config to find sqlite you may need to set:
export PKG_CONFIG_PATH="/opt/homebrew/opt/sqlite/lib/pkgconfig"
Taking the advice from Homebrew, I set bundle config build.sqlite3 --with-sqlite3-include=$(brew --prefix sqlite)/include --with-sqlite3-lib=$(brew --prefix sqlite)/lib
but I got what appears to be the same result.
Can somebody please tell me what's the correct way to install this gem given this setup? Thank you very much.
In case anyone else stumbles along this, I had a similar issue. I have my dev environment set up part emulated and part ARM.
To navigate this, I have two different versions of Homebrew installed. One version is for M1 architecture, which lives in /opt/homebrew/
. And I have a version of Homebrew that runs on x86 architecture that lives in /usr/local/Homebrew
.
I have the x86 version aliased to ibrew
, like this:
alias ibrew='arch --x86_64 /usr/local/Homebrew/bin/brew'
(See this answer for more info on running two separate Homebrew versions.)
OP's bundle config command worked for me, I just had to swap out brew
for ibrew
:
bundle config build.sqlite3 --with-sqlite3-include=$(brew --prefix sqlite)/include --with-sqlite3-lib=$(brew --prefix sqlite)/lib
